U.S. Consumers Spend < 2% On "Made In China"

Posted: 10 Aug 2011 07:22 PM PDT

 
A new paper from the San Francisco Fed “The U.S. Content of ‘Made in China’” has been getting a lot of blog attention, see Matt Yglesias, Doug Henwood and Tim Fernholz (HTs to Steve Bartin and Jonah Goldberg).  One of the main points of the article is:

“Whereas goods labeled "Made in China" make up 2.7% of U.S. consumer spending, only 1.2% actually reflects the cost of the imported goods. Markets In Everything: Union Strike Services

Posted: 10 Aug 2011 06:01 PM PDT

1. There's a market for unions to hire non-union protesters, e.g. in Nashville at the Music City Convention Center (see photo above).  There's one problem though: the protesters hired by the union are paid $10 per hour (with no benefits), which is below the Tennessee prevailing hourly wage of $12.56 for general laborers.
